There needs to be a baby changing toilet in men’s toilets as well as women’s!

Rejected 10 signatures

What the petition asks

The amount of times my partner has gone to take our baby out and has struggled to find a baby changing toilet that wasn’t in the women’s toilets to change his babies nappy!
It’s unfair on all dads / male guardians, they take their babies out for a fun day out or even a simple shopping trip and are 95% of the time, unable to change their child’s nappy or clothes due to not having access to a changing room / unit. The women’s toilets, 98% of the time, have a baby changing toilet. So why don’t men? How are they supposed to care for their babies when they can’t even change them in private?

Why it was rejected

There was already a petition about this issue. Duplicates are rejected so signatures collect in one place.

There aren't currently legal requirements for businesses to provide baby changing facilities in men or women's toilets. If you'd like businesses to be required to provide baby changing facilities in all toilets you might like to sign the following petition.
